Hot August Nights 2026 Dates
- Spring Fever Revival: May 8 – 9 at Atlantis (teaser event)
- Virginia City Kickoff: July 31 – August 1 (400-vehicle cap)
- Main Event (Reno-Sparks): August 2 – 9
- Drag Races & Burnouts: August 6 – 8 (Thu–Sat)
- Grand Finale Parade: August 9 · 9 AM (UNR → RSCC)
Hot August Nights Tickets & Pricing
- General Admission: FREE (show-n-shines, concerts, cruises)
- Vehicle Registration: $155 – $260 (caps at 6,000 cars)
- Drag Race Spectator: Tickets at the gate
- Auctions: Admission at Convention Center
Most events are free. You do not need to register a car to attend.

Hot August Nights 2026 Daily Schedule
Day-by-day breakdown of the official 2026 schedule. Each day links what's happening, where, and the headline evening act. Times are subject to change — confirm at hotaugustnights.net.
Virginia City Kickoff (Day 1)
Fri, Jul 31Hot August Nights opens with the Virginia City kickoff — classic cars on C Street, Wing Fest, plus Summit Racing show-n-shine in Sparks, Burnout Bar action, and AMSOIL drag races at the Nugget. Strong opening day before the busy Reno-Sparks stretch begins.
Virginia City Kickoff (Day 2)
Sat, Aug 1Virginia City day 2 + Wing Fest in downtown Reno + burnouts and AMSOIL drag races at the Nugget continue. Best early date for visitors who want event energy without the late-week crowd peak.
Registration & Cruisin' for the Cure
Sun, Aug 2Registration and check-in activity opens at J Resort. Bonanza Casino hosts ‘Cruisin' for the Cure’ — a charity-focused car show with a community vibe before the core downtown week ramps up.
Peppermill + Atlantis Activate
Mon, Aug 3Peppermill and Atlantis open their venue programming — open cruise activity, craft fair, specialty vehicle displays, judged events. Multi-venue footprint of the week starts filling out.
Downtown Reno Opens · Elvis Tribute
Tue, Aug 4Downtown Reno opens as a major host zone. Poker Walk registration gets underway. Evening entertainment: Kraig Parker as Elvis tribute. Best transition day before the late-week rush.
Downtown Sparks Joins · Music Night
Wed, Aug 5Downtown Sparks opens into the main event mix. Judged competitions continue. Evening concerts: Turn the Page in Sparks + The Rocket Man Show in Reno.
Swap Meet + Auctions + WAR/Herman's
Thu, Aug 6One of the biggest days. Swap Meet opens at J Resort, MAG Auctions begin at the Reno-Sparks Convention Center, controlled cruises roll through both Reno and Sparks. Headline concerts: Herman's Hermits starring Peter Noone in Reno + WAR in Sparks.
Women with Wheelz + Tommy James
Fri, Aug 7Women With Wheelz showcase (new for 2026, first 100 women only). Prom Night, more auctions, controlled cruising. Headline concerts: Tommy James & The Shondells in Reno + Paperback Writer in Sparks.
Event Series Finale · Youth Automotive Challenge · Blood, Sweat & Tears
Sat, Aug 8Event Series Finale, plus the Youth Automotive Challenge (team competition for participants 21 and under, designing/judging vehicles for vocational scholarships). Saturday-night concerts: Blood, Sweat & Tears in Reno + Miami Sound Revue in Sparks.
Grand Finale Parade (UNR → RSCC)
Sun, Aug 9Parade of Champions at 8:30 AM in downtown Reno, then the Grand Finale Parade at 9:00 AM rolling from the University of Nevada to the Reno-Sparks Convention Center. The closing-day moment.
Concerts & Headline Entertainment 2026
The 2026 lineup runs as free nightly concerts split between downtown Reno and downtown Sparks. Times and venues confirmed on the official entertainment page at hotaugustnights.net/entertainment.
| Date | Reno Stage | Sparks Stage |
|---|---|---|
| Tue, Aug 4 | Kraig Parker as Elvis | — |
| Wed, Aug 5 | The Rocket Man Show | Turn the Page |
| Thu, Aug 6 | Herman's Hermits starring Peter Noone | WAR |
| Fri, Aug 7 | Tommy James & The Shondells | Paperback Writer |
| Sat, Aug 8 | Blood, Sweat & Tears | Miami Sound Revue |
All headline concerts are free with general admission. Times typically 7–9 PM — arrive 60–90 minutes early on the bigger nights (Aug 7–8) to claim space.
Grand Finale Parade — Sun Aug 9
The 40th-anniversary finale runs on Sunday morning. Parade of Champions kicks off at 8:30 AM in downtown Reno, followed by the Grand Finale Parade at 9:00 AM, which rolls from the University of Nevada to the Reno-Sparks Convention Center. Hundreds of classic cars on the route — this is the can't-miss closing moment of the 10-day festival.
Local tip: Park at the Caesars resort garages by 8:00 AM and walk to the route. Virginia Street and side streets will close for the parade. Brunch at a downtown spot afterward — see our restaurant guide for picks.

Parking & Getting Around
Parking is Limited
The official advice: use ride-shares, taxis, or free shuttles between venues. Do not plan to drive between event locations.
Free Inter-Venue Shuttles
Complimentary regional shuttle buses run between Peppermill, Atlantis, GSR, J Resort, and downtown Sparks. Use them — driving between venues is impractical.
Downtown
Use hotel garages (free for guests at Caesars resorts). Street parking is scarce.
Sparks
Victorian Square Theater Garage holds 700 cars. Arrive early for drag race nights.
Trailers
Most hotels do NOT allow trailers. Use the designated Hot August Nights Trailer Lot at 185 N Edison Way (Edison Lot).
Airport
Fly into Reno-Tahoe International (RNO). Most hotels offer airport shuttles.
